The sockets used in Dominican Republic
Type A
Two flat parallel pins. Used across North America, Central America and Japan.
Type B
Two flat pins plus a round earth pin. Common in North America and Japan.

Dominican Republic plug FAQ
What plug do they use in Dominican Republic?
Dominican Republic uses Type A, Type B power sockets, running on 120V at 60 Hz.
Do I need a travel adapter for Dominican Republic?
It depends where you are from. United States: no adapter needed. United Kingdom: yes, a Type A/B adapter. Germany: yes, a Type A/B adapter. Australia: yes, a Type A/B adapter.
Do I need a voltage converter in Dominican Republic?
Dominican Republic runs on 120V. Phones, laptops and most chargers are dual-voltage (100-240V) and only need a plug adapter. Single-voltage devices may need a converter, so check the label.
